Hardwood Floor Removal in Denver, CO
Hardwood floor removal services involve the careful and efficient process of taking out existing hardwood flooring to prepare a space for new flooring or other renovation projects. This service covers a variety of projects, including removing old or damaged hardwood planks, preparing subfloors for new installations, or clearing space for other flooring types such as tile or carpet. Homeowners typically seek this service when updating their interiors, addressing water or termite damage, or renovating to change the aesthetic of a room. It’s important for property owners to understand the scope of the removal process, including potential dust and debris, as well as any necessary preparation or repairs to the underlying surface.
Before requesting hardwood floor removal, property owners often want to know about the extent of the work involved and how it might impact their space. Questions about the removal method, potential for surface damage, and whether the existing subfloor will need repairs or refinishing are common. Clarifying these details can help ensure that the project aligns with renovation goals and that any additional work, such as disposal or surface preparation, is accounted for. Proper planning can make the transition smoother and support the successful completion of subsequent flooring or renovation steps.

Hardwood Floor Removal Questions
What types of hardwood floors can be removed? Most common hardwood flooring types, such as oak, maple, and hickory, can be removed with proper techniques.
Is hardwood floor removal messy? The process can create dust and debris, but professional removal minimizes disruption and clean-up is typically straightforward.
Can hardwood floor removal be done during a renovation? Yes, it is often part of remodeling projects, especially when replacing or refinishing subfloors or installing new flooring.
What should homeowners do before removal begins? Clear the area of furniture and belongings to ensure safe and efficient removal of the flooring.
